UFMylation suppresses Type IFN signaling during <i>Mycobacterium tuberculosis</i> infection of human macrophages
2024-08-07
Abstract excerpt
<h4>ABSTRACT</h4> Type I Interferons (IFN-I) promote host defense against a wide range of viral infections, but inhibit control of several bacterial pathogens, including Mycobacterium tuberculosis (Mtb). Given the significance of IFN-I signaling in determining Mtb infection outcomes, we sought to uncover new molecular mechanisms that regulate IFN-I during mycobacterial infection, specifically focusing on how IFN...
